Finance

MediShield Life vs Integrated Shield Plan: What's the Real Cost Gap?

MediShield Life covers B2/C ward hospitalisation. An Integrated Shield Plan upgrades you to A ward or private hospital. The annual premium gap is $300–$1,500 depending on age and plan tier — but the real cost difference at claim time can be $20,000–$80,000.
